Scaling and root planing is a common gum procedure to clean the teeth above together with below the gum sections and poses no risk to the mother and unborn child.   Premature birth is a significant problem in the usa with nearly 12 percent with the babies being born preterm (just before 37 weeks of maternity).   Preterm birth results in increased death and other tough problems for these little ones. Before becoming pregnant just about all women should seek some sort of gum and tooth exam as a way of avoiding this serious complication of pregnancy.   For ladies who are already expecting a baby when gum disease is usually detected, scaling and origin planing can still guide.   This treatment should probably be carried out in the other trimester.   Treatment for gum disease comprises several modalities.   Most common is running and root planing to fix the hard and delicate deposits above and below the gum line.   At the same time the dentist may employ various antimicrobial agents placed in the space between that gums and tooth to help fight the bacteria and enhance the healing.  

For people whose periodontitis has modified the gums and bone an excessive amount, various surgical therapies are often applied.   Depending relating to the nature of the disease, new bone and gums may very well be grafted in localized sites to boost the condition.   For patients whose dental supporting bone loss is indeed great that they drop a tooth, dental implants may very well be an option to replace what they’ve already lost.   Some treatments for any gums focus on cosmetics.   These procedures in many cases are called oral plastic surgery.   Patients with a gummy smile (a display of excessive gum when they smile) may be helped by reshaping the gums.   Patients through an irregular line of gums, or with gum recession on individual teeth may be helped with various techniques to restore missing gum tissue.   This often has not just a cosmetic benefit but, also allows you to cover exposed root surfaces which might be painfully sensitive to ingredients and cold liquids.
